Official IQ Assessments: The Wechsler Spouse and children and Past

The Wechsler Intelligence Scales dominate the landscape of official pediatric IQ screening, with unique variations suitable for specific age ranges and reasons. The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for kids, Fifth Edition (WISC-V) serves as the key evaluation Software for faculty-aged children from 6 to 16 many years previous. This thorough battery evaluates 5 Key index scores that alongside one another add to an entire Scale IQ rating.

The WISC-V's Verbal Comprehension Index steps crystallized intelligence by subtests like Vocabulary, where by small children determine text of increasing difficulty, and Similarities, which requires identifying interactions concerning principles. The Visible Spatial Index assesses the opportunity to Consider visual particulars and comprehend spatial relationships through responsibilities like Block Structure, wherever little ones recreate designs making use of colored cubes, and Visible Puzzles, which require mentally rotating and manipulating objects.

The Fluid Reasoning Index evaluates the capability to solve novel problems as a result of subtests for instance Matrix Reasoning, the place youngsters determine styles and reasonable relationships, and Determine Weights, which calls for knowing quantitative interactions. The Performing Memory Index measures a chance to briefly hold and manipulate facts by way of Digit Span and Picture Span jobs. Ultimately, the Processing Velocity Index assesses the pace and precision of cognitive processing by way of Image Research and Coding subtests.

For younger little ones aged 2 yrs 6 months by 7 yrs 7 months, the Wechsler Preschool and first Scale of Intelligence, Fourth Version (WPPSI-IV) supplies developmentally appropriate assessment. This Variation incorporates a lot more manipulative and Participate in-based mostly things to do although protecting demanding psychometric benchmarks. The check framework varies by age, with more youthful young children obtaining much less subtests to support shorter attention spans.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Edition (SB-5) gives an alternate detailed assessment suitable for individuals aged two through 85 several years. This examination is particularly valuable for assessing young children with Fantastic capabilities or developmental delays as a consequence of its prolonged array and adaptive screening format. The SB-five evaluates five cognitive variables: Fluid Reasoning, Information, Quantitative Reasoning, Visible-Spatial Processing, and Working Memory, Just about every assessed by both verbal and nonverbal modalities.

Supplemental specialized assessments include the Kaufman Assessment Battery for kids, 2nd Edition (KABC-II), which emphasizes processing abilities more than acquired information, which makes it specially practical for youngsters from diverse cultural backgrounds or People with language challenges. The Cognitive Assessment Process, Second Edition (CAS-2) is based on neuropsychological concept and evaluates arranging, consideration, simultaneous processing, and successive processing qualities.

Specialised Assessments and Cultural Concerns

Present day IQ tests has evolved to address considerations about cultural bias and assorted learning types. The Universal Nonverbal Intelligence Take a look at (Device-two) eradicates language specifications totally, which makes it suited to children with hearing impairments, language delays, or limited English proficiency. Likewise, the Examination of Nonverbal Intelligence, Fourth Edition (TONI-4) employs only pointing and gesturing responses, taking away verbal and penned language boundaries.

Some non-public schools particularly look for these substitute assessments when evaluating college students from various backgrounds or These with Understanding distinctions. These educational institutions identify that classic verbal-weighty assessments might not precisely reflect the cognitive abilities of all small children, significantly Those people whose to start with language will not be English or who definitely have distinct Finding out disabilities affecting language processing.
